Stem cell clinics selling risky treatments explode across the country
Pharmacy Today, American Pharmacists Association, pharmacist.com The availability of experimental stem cell treatments has been widely underestimated in the United States, according to researchers, who warn that unapproved procedures pose a threat to patients’ pocketbooks and their health. Good vibrations: ‘jiggling’ stem cells that turn into bone offer revolutionary new treatment for osteoporosis
Telegraph.co.uk New treatments for osteoporosis or broken bones are on the horizon after scientists discovered they can grow new bone simply by vibrating stem cells. Currently the only option for patients who suffer complicated breaks is to undergo painful surgery … |
